Description
|
COMPLAINT MANAGEMENT: Receives and investigates complaints/concerns made by or on behalf of residents of nursing homes and assisted living facilities. Provides information on long term care issues in general, residents' rights, long term care facilities, and elder abuse. Advocates for improvements of state, federal, and local laws and regulations that affect long term care facility residents.

Volunteer Requirements
|
21 and older.
|
Volunteer Duties
|
Visit residents in nursing homes with Ombudsman, receive and investigate complaints. Free training provided.
